Mobile Low-dose CT Screening for Lung Cancer in Ages 40-54
This study is looking at whether mobile low-dose computed tomography (LDCT) screening can help find lung cancer in people aged 40-54. LDCT is a special type of X-ray that takes detailed pictures of your lungs. Previous studies have shown that LDCT screening helps people aged 55 and older with a strong smoking history live longer. However, some people develop this smoking history before they reach age 55. This study aims to see if screening at a younger age (40-54) can help detect lung cancer earlier in this high-risk group. The main goal is to see how many lung cancer diagnoses are made in this age group after their first mobile LDCT screening.

What this trial measures
- Lung cancer diagnosis rate in individuals 40-54 years of age at their first screening (T0) with mobile low-dose CT.1 day
The lung cancer diagnosis variable will be determined for each subject as a binary variable indicating whether or not the subject's T0 screening results in a diagnosis of lung cancer.
